The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
MORNINGTON GROVE E3 1. 4431 (West Side) Nos 9 to 20 (consec) TQ 3782 12/315 II GV 2. Late C19. In pairs except Nos 16 to 20 form a small terrace. Stock brick with wide bracketed eaves and soffit to hipped slate roofs. 3 storeys and basement, 2 windows each, centres slightly advanced on each side of shallow brick groove which divides paired houses. Ground floors with 3 light windows, stuccoed architraves bracketed sills and pediments above. 1st floors have a 3 light and a a single round headed window. Above similar with flat arches. Doors arched with stucco dressings carried up into unusual keystones. Balustraded steps. Blind, full height, recessed brick arches in side facades.
Nos 9 to 20 (consec) form a group with their garden walls and piers and with the wall at the southern end of Mornington Grove.
